Když stáhnete velký soubor, například distribuci Linuxu ve formě ISO, měli byste jej ověřit, abyste se ujistili, že byl soubor stažen správně - bez chyb a neoprávněných úprav.
Vývojáři velkých souborů, jako jsou ISO, spouštějí tyto dokončené obrázky prostřednictvím programu a generují šifrovaný soubor MD5. Tato metoda poskytuje jedinečný kontrolní součet, což je otisk prstu souboru.
Stáhnete ISO a poté spustíte nástroj, který vytvoří kontrolní součet MD5 proti tomuto souboru. Kontrolní součet, který se vrátí, by se měl shodovat s kontrolním součtem na webu vývojáře softwaru.
Stahování souboru s kontrolním součtem MD5
Chcete-li předvést, jak ověřit kontrolní součet souboru, budete potřebovat soubor, který již má kontrolní součet MD5 k dispozici pro porovnání.
Většina linuxových distribucí poskytuje pro své ISO obrazy kontrolní součet SHA nebo MD5. Jedna distribuce, která používá metodu kontrolního součtu MD5 k ověření souboru, je Bodhi Linux.
Stáhněte si živou verzi systému Bodhi Linux ze stránky http://www.bodhilinux.com/.
Odkazovaná stránka nabízí tři verze:
- Standard
- Vydání AppPack
- Starší verze
Stáhněte si dva soubory: Bodhi Linux ISO, který je k dispozici na odkazu ke stažení, a soubor MD5. Porovnáte kontrolní součet, který vidíte v souboru MD5, s kontrolním součtem, který získáte v relaci prostředí.
-
Stáhněte si samotnou ISO kliknutím na odkaz Stáhnout v části Standardní vydání.
-
klikněte MD5 stáhněte soubor kontrolního součtu MD5 do počítače.
-
Otevřete soubor MD5 v textovém editoru. Obsah vypadá asi takto:
ba411cafee2f0f702572369da0b765e2 bodhi-4.1.0-64.iso
Ověřte kontrolní součet MD5 pomocí systému Windows
Ověření kontrolního součtu MD5:
-
Otevřete příkazový řádek.
-
Otevřete složku ke stažení zadáním cd Stahování. Pokud jste soubory uložili na jiném místě, přejděte tam.
-
typ certutil -hashfile následuje název souboru a poté MD5.
-
Zkontrolujte, zda se vrácená hodnota shoduje s hodnotou souboru MD5, který jste stáhli z webu Bodhi (a otevřeli v poznámkovém bloku).
-
Pokud se hodnoty neshodují, soubor není platný a měli byste si jej stáhnout znovu.
Ověřte kontrolní součet MD5 pomocí systému Linux
Chcete-li ověřit kontrolní součet MD5 pomocí systému Linux, postupujte podle těchto pokynů:
-
Otevřete relaci prostředí a poté přejděte do adresáře, do kterého jste stáhli soubory.
-
vstoupit md5sum následuje název souboru.
-
Hodnota zobrazená příkazem md5sum by se měla shodovat s hodnotou v souboru MD5.
úvahy
Metoda md5sum kontroly platnosti souboru funguje, pouze pokud je zabezpečený web, ze kterého stahujete software. Funguje dobře, když je k dispozici spousta zrcadel, protože se můžete kdykoli podívat na hlavní web.
Pokud však někdo hackne hlavní web a vetřelci změní kontrolní součet na webu, pravděpodobně stahujete něco, co nechcete použít.
Pokud kontrolní součet souboru neodpovídá hodnotě v doplňkovém souboru ke stažení, víte, že soubor byl nějakým způsobem poškozen. Zkuste to znovu stáhnout. Pokud několik pokusů selže, informujte vlastníka souboru nebo správce webu, který jej poskytuje.